The «Memory of the Fishermen of Fuzeta in Dura Faina do Bacalhau» is the theme of Manuel Pereira's lecture, scheduled for Saturday, December 2, at the Sala Multiusos da Fuzeta (on Av. 25 de Abril, in front of the Camping Park and next to the Caixa Agrícola counter).

The initiative, which is open to the public, is organized by the Foz do Eta Association, the Union of Parishes of Moncarapacho and Fuzeta and APOS -Association for the Valorization of the Cultural and Environmental Heritage of Olhão.

The fishing village of Fuzeta was one of the places that more fishermen provided, in the Algarve, to the white fleet, as the Portuguese cod fishing fleet in the Newfoundland seas was known in the mid-twentieth century. It was such a difficult activity that men were given the choice between going to the codfish or going to the army.
